What does pack battery mean?
A battery pack is a set of batteries or battery cells arranged in series or parallel to supply power. It stores energy for devices like electric vehicles. Battery packs can be primary (non-rechargeable) or secondary (rechargeable) and usually use lithium-ion cells. Proper packaging, sealing, and assembly are essential for performance.

What does inverter interchange 220v mean
Most power inverters are designed to convert 12-volt, 24-volt, or 48-volt DC to 120-volt AC. These inverters are commonly used in recreation vehicles and solar power systems. Special inverters can be connected together to produce 220-volts. This process is called stacking.
